The methods by which a transmission repair
establishment does business can tip off a car owner to its reliability. Generally,
reliable transmission experts will follow certain procedures when a vehicle is brought in
with a suspected transmission malfunction. The procedures should run along these lines:
The service personnel carefully question the
owner about the vehicles operation.
The transmission fluid is checked.
The condition of the motor mounts are
considered.
The vehicle is given a road test to allow the
mechanic to experience driving performance.
The car is examined, put on a lift if
necessary, and carefully checked by the mechanic for all possible external causes of the
difficulty.
